Bioerosion by microbial euendoliths in benthic foraminifera from heavy metal-polluted coastal environments of Portovesme (south-western Sardinia, Italy)
[摘要] A monitoring survey of the coastal area facing theindustrial area of Portoscuso-Portovesme (south-western Sardinia, Italy)revealed intense bioerosional processes. Benthic foraminifera collected atthe same depth (about 2 m) but at different distances from the pollutionsource show extensive microbial infestation, anomalous Mg/Ca molar ratiosand high levels of heavy metals in the shell associated with a decrease inforaminifera richness, population density and biodiversity with the presenceof morphologically abnormal specimens. We found that carbonate dissolutioninduced by euendoliths is selective, depending on the Mg content andmorpho-structural types of foraminiferal taxa. This study provides evidencesfor a connection between heavy metal dispersion, decrease in pH of thesea-water and bioerosional processes on foraminifera.
